Transponder keys

A key that has a chip transponder is a great option to protect your car from theft. It transmits a specific signal to the immobilizer system of the vehicle, preventing the car from starting without a key. However, these keys may be more expensive to replace than conventional keys. You should keep a spare in case you lose your keys.

Transponders are fitted in most BMWs, making them less difficult to steal. The transponder chip emits an unique code that is wirelessly transmitted through the key and read by the car's computer. It will only begin the engine if the key is within reach of the car's immobilizer. The chip transmits the signal to the ignition lock. This prevents the car from starting even if the key isn't present.

Finding your VIN is the initial step in obtaining a new key. This is a 17-character code that is specific to your BMW. It is located on your vehicle registration document or insurance policy, or on your title. The VIN is required to confirm that you are the owner of the vehicle and to prevent unauthorized key duplication.

Once you have the VIN Contact your local dealership to order the replacement key. Most dealerships will do this however it could take some time. If you're in a hurry, consider calling an independent locksmith or auto repair shop to avoid the lengthy waiting time.

Battery Replacement

When it comes to your automobile the key fob is the most convenient way to unlock your doors and start your engine in Marietta. A key fob's battery is the only element that allows it to function, so it's important to replace it before its lifespan expires. It's simple to replace the battery on your BMW key fob, and you don't require any special tools or knowledge. It's just five minutes!

The first step is to locate the battery. Once you have located it, you can remove the valet and use a screwdriver in order to open the case. It will reveal a tiny gap that is where the battery needs to be. Carefully remove the battery and replace it with the new one. Be sure to align the battery correctly. Close the case and press both halves until a snapping sound can be heard.

It is essential to programme your new battery in the specific model of your BMW. Every car manufacturer and model has its own procedure for this, so make sure to refer to the owner's manual for specific instructions. This usually involves pressing a variety of buttons in a sequential manner, but this can vary according to the car.
